The Maharal's Lost Continent, Pt. II
Second in a three-part series on the history of science and the nature of nature.
In Part I of this planned trilogy, we discussed the Maharal of Prague’s location of the Land of Israel at the center of the cosmos and his defining of the center as that place mediating between the qualities of North, South, East, and West.
